Mid Sussex District Council (20 005 097)

Category : Other Categories > Other

Decision : Closed after initial enquiries

Decision date : 22 Jan 2021

The Ombudsman's final decision:

Summary: Mr X complained about the Council’s lack of consultation regarding the closure of a community venue. We cannot investigate the complaint because the local group with which Mr X is involved has taken legal action against the Council and so the complaint falls outside our jurisdiction.

The complaint

  1. The complainant, who I refer to as Mr X, complained about the Council’s lack of consultation regarding the closure of a community venue. He wanted the Council to retract its decision and engage with the community and local user groups.

The Ombudsman’s role and powers

  1. The Local Government Act 1974 sets out our powers but also imposes restrictions on what we can investigate.
  2. We cannot investigate a complaint if someone has taken court action about the matter. (Local Government Act 1974, section 26(6)(c), as amended)

What I found

  1. Mr X complained to us about the Council’s failure to consult with the community and local user groups in deciding to close a community venue.
  2. In the meantime, the local group Mr X is involved with took legal action to challenge the Council’s position. This has resulted in a court order being made which requires the Council to undertake public consultation before any further decision is taken about the long-term use of the venue.
  3. As the group with which Mr X is involved has taken legal action against the Council the complaint falls outside our jurisdiction and cannot be pursued.

Final decision

  1. This complaint will not be investigated because the local group with which Mr X is involved has taken legal action against the Council and so the complaint falls outside our jurisdiction.
